Abstract

Solitary papillary muscle (PM) hypertrophy is an unique type of hypertrophic cardiomyopathy (HCM), which is characterized by predominant papillary muscle hypertrophy sparing the rest of other left ventricular segments. It has recently drawn our attention about the mechanism of left ventricular mid-cavity obstruction and the influence of pressure gradient in the left ventricular outflow tract (LVOT), thus carries clinical importance.
